Your SlideShare is downloading. ×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×

Introducing the official SlideShare app

Stunning, full-screen experience for iPhone and Android

Text the download link to your phone

Standard text messaging rates apply

Herramientas Monitoreo SQL Server

5,399
views

Published on

Variedad de herramientas que se pueden utilizar para el monitoreo y optimización de SQL Server.

Variedad de herramientas que se pueden utilizar para el monitoreo y optimización de SQL Server.


0 Comments
1 Like
Statistics
Notes
  • Be the first to comment

No Downloads
Views
Total Views
5,399
On Slideshare
0
From Embeds
0
Number of Embeds
6
Actions
Shares
0
Downloads
32
Comments
0
Likes
1
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. Herramientas de Afinamiento en SQL Server Expositor: Adrián Miranda Cordero amiranda@gpilatam.com
  • 2. Sobre Mi Senior Database Administrator Database Manager, GPI Consultores MCDBA, MCSE, MCSA, MCITP, MCTS, MCT, MCP 12 años de experiencia en la administración de base de datos SQL Server, inicié trabajando con la versión 7.0 hasta la versión 2012. Me especializo en tema de Rendimiento, afinamiento, alta disponibilidad, desastre y recuperación y arquitectura de base de datos en general. Me gusta disfrutar la vida al máximo, he aprendido a no ver los problemas como algo estresante si no como oportunidades para demostrar que todo en la vida tiene su sitio y depende de nosotros mismos si permitimos que nos afecte.
  • 3. Organizadores
  • 4. Agenda • Análisis de problemas • • • • Hardware Software SQL Server Diseño de Base de Datos • Herramientas de Análisis • • • • Contadores de Rendimiento Vistas Dinámicas SQL Server Profiler Eventos Extendidos Preguntas al Twitter Hashtag: #RinconSQL
  • 5. Introducción “La aplicación está muy lenta”
  • 6. Análisis de problemas Qué debemos analizar? Hardware Windows Tablas, Índices SQL Server Query’s
  • 7. Cómo Análizar Herramientas Monitoreo • Task Manager • Performance Monitor Múltiples Recursos • Data Collector, Extended Events • Activity Monitor, Execution Plans, Profiler, Vistas Dinámicas Herramientas de Terceros • SQL Sentry (Plan Explorer) • Idera (Solo usen los trials)
  • 8. Herramientas Task Manager
  • 9. Task Manager
  • 10. Herramientas Performance Monitor
  • 11. Performance Monitor
  • 12. Herramientas Activity Monitor
  • 13. Performance Monitor
  • 14. Herramientas SQL Server Profiler
  • 15. Profiler
  • 16. Herramientas Vistas Dinámicas
  • 17. Vistas Dinámicas • Devuelven información referente al estado del servidor de base de datos par diagnosticar problemas y resolver problemas de rendimiento. • Funciones y vistas de administración dinámica con ámbito en el servidor. Se requiere el permiso VIEW SERVER STATE en el servidor. • Funciones y vistas de administración dinámica con ámbito en la base de datos. Se requiere el permiso VIEW DATABASE STATE en la base de datos.
  • 18. Vistas Dinámicas • • • • • • • • Common Language Runtime Database Transacciones Execution SQL Server OS Security Index IO
  • 19. Reflexión Final • Documente su plataforma actual, haga inventario • Analice bien el diseño de base de datos, los índices a crear y los tipos de datos a utilizar • Analice su estrategia de recuperación en caso de desastre. • Maximice la utilización de sus recursos, no resuelva sus problemas de rendimiento adquiriendo mas hardware.
  • 20. Preguntas
  • 21. Información de contacto Como contactarme? amiranda@nemesyscr.com amiranda@gpilatam.com cr.linkedin.com/in/admiranda/ www.slideshare.net/adrianmiranda www.adrian-miranda-gpi.blogspot.com
  • 22. Comunidad https://www.facebook.com/groups/elrincondesqlserver/ http://www.youtube.com/user/elrincondesqlserver http://www.elrincondesqlserver.com/